Current Positions. From time to time it may be asserted by either a member, the Association or the District that the duties performed by the member are beyond the scope of the job description for the current classification. The process to petition for a determination as to whether the position should be reclassified to a higher classification is a follows: a. At the request of the Association, the District shall provide relevant job descriptions for each classification. b. The petitioner shall submit a completed official position description form and written explanation for the reclassification request to the District. c. The District shall have thirty (30) calendar days after receipt of the request to review the affected job descriptions, investigate the merits of the request, make a determination and notify the member of the outcome. d. If the reclassification is granted, the member currently employed in the position shall continue to be employed in the new position. e. Reclassifications shall not be retroactive, the effective date of the reclassification shall be the first day of the month following the month of determination. f. Denial of a petition for reclassification is not subject to the grievance procedures of Article 3 of this agreement.
